Uttar Pradesh (Uttar Pradesh)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ath (Yogi Adityanath) Has distributed portfolios to its ministers. Deputy CM Keshav Maurya (Keshav Prasad Maurya) The important Public Works Department has been removed from Second Deputy CM Brajesh Pathak (Brijesh Pathak) has been given to the Departments of Medical-Health and Medical Education. According to the portfolio list released by Raj Bhavan late on Monday evening, Yogi has kept 34 departments including Home with him.
Jitin Prasada promoted in Yogi 2.0
At the same time, the stature of Jitin Prasad, who was made a minister a few months before the elections in Yogi Sarkar 1.0, has increased in Yogiraj 2.0. An important department like Public Works Department (PWD) has been given to Jitin Prasad, who came from Congress. Jitin Prasad was given the charge of Technical Education Department in Yogiraj 1.0. Jitin Prasad, who joined the BJP last year after leaving the Congress, was allotted technical education in the last few months of the previous Yogi government. Allotment of PWD department to him this time is being seen as promotion.
At the same time, the charge of Technical Education Department has been given to Ashish Patel, who was made minister from Apna Dal’s quota. While another newcomer, former IAS officer and former PMO officer AK Sharma, has been given the Department of Urban Development and Jal Shakti.

In Yogi Sarkar 2.0, the Deputy CM Keshav Prasad Maurya has been cut off. The Public Works Department has been replaced with six departments, which include Rural Development, Rural Engineering, Food Processing, Entertainment Tax, Public Enterprises and National Integration. However, he has been given full charge of health, family welfare and medical education. In the previous Yogi government, there were two ministers handling health and medical education separately. The two portfolios given to AK Sharma were also handled by two ministers Ashutosh Tandon and Shrikant Sharma in the previous government. This time both have been thrown out. Sharma, who hails from Mau district, had opted for VRS two years before his retirement to become BJP MLC in 2021 and was waiting to get a ministerial post.
Yogi kept these 34 departments with him, Swatantra Dev Singh’s stature increased
The 34 departments that Yogi has kept with him include Home, Recruitment, Personnel, Information, Housing and Town Planning, Administrative Reforms and Planning. When he took over as CM in 2017, Yogi had 36 departments. In subsequent reshuffles, this number was reduced. Among other senior ministers, Suresh Khanna has retained finance and parliamentary affairs, while SP Shahi has retained agriculture and agricultural education and research. BJP’s state president and now cabinet minister Swatantra Dev Singh has been given seven departments including Jal Shakti and Namami Gange. He has the most departments after the CM. These departments were earlier with Mahendra Singh, who could not get a place in the cabinet this time.
